一种基于移动设备的防截屏方法及系统技术方案

技术编号:38077850 阅读:9 留言:0更新日期:2023-07-06 08:45
本申请涉及一种基于移动设备的防截屏方法及系统,通过云端的脱敏识别和判断方式,对终端截屏页面进行敏感信息识别,对于符合敏感特征的截屏,通过向用户发出警示查看的方式,提示用户注意截屏的敏感性,在将截屏展示给用户之前,提前让用户获知待展示截屏的敏感性,以此让用户在作出是否确定展示当前截屏之后,再进行截屏展示。且用户在查看截屏告警提示时,可以通过提示页面的关键词获知当前敏感信息所属的敏感信息类型及其应用类型,可对多个终端上的应用提供敏感词识别和判断。该方式将应用以及截屏操作信息包含的截屏以及截屏图文识别部署在云端,可以减轻终端的运算压力,节省资源,大大降低智能终端内的运行线程,提高终端内的运行能力。高终端内的运行能力。高终端内的运行能力。

【技术实现步骤摘要】
一种基于移动设备的防截屏方法及系统


[0001]本公开涉及电子设备操控
,尤其涉及一种基于移动设备的防截屏方法及系统。

技术介绍

[0002]终端防截屏手段,目的在于对敏感信息进行防截屏处理,避免敏感信息的截屏信息泄露。
[0003]现有的防截屏手段,多种多样,比如说明书附图1所示的目前智能终端机中所具备的“防恶意截屏录屏”功能,用户打开该功能后,能够对用户的截屏操作进行监控,当检测到用户的截屏操作后,发现涉及到敏感信息的截屏操作时,会通过掩盖等方式提前将截屏信息遮挡,待用户确认后方可退出掩码,显露出原始截屏码(截屏图像)。该功能存在如下问题:一是不是所有机型皆具备“防恶意截屏录屏”功能;二是其显露出原始截屏码后,其上仍然存在涉及到该截屏截屏图像的敏感信息,仍然存在敏感信息泄露的风险。
[0004]虽然也有对截屏敏感信息进行处理的方案,如公开号为CN110363024A的专利技术专利提供了一种“基于移动设备应用的防截屏方法”,通过获取应用内需要防截屏的敏感信息内容;将所述敏感信息内容转变为具有数字认证的流媒体格式数据;以及将所述流媒体格式数据输送到所述应用的界面上。无需对用户操作进行监控,也无需对用户的截图进行处理,只需要将页面中需要显示的敏感信息内容转变为具有数字认证的流媒体格式,在用户进行截屏操作时并不会得到敏感信息内容,在页面中不含有敏感信息内容时,用户可自由进行截屏,因此既不占用移动设备过多的计算资源,也便于用户使用。
[0005]上述专利,虽然能够对截屏图像上的敏感信息进行处理,在用户进行截屏操作时不会得到敏感信息内容,但是同样存在如下问题:(1)其预先定义的需要防截屏的敏感信息内容,可能来自不同应用,大量调取应用并定义各个应用中的敏感信息,需要占用较多的线程和终端运行资源进行处理;(2)用户截屏时,只知道所截屏内容属于敏感信息的内容,但是用户并不知道其到底属于哪种敏感信息类型;(3)虽然在页面中不含有敏感信息内容时,其用户可自由进行截屏,但是前期的敏感信息处理上,还是需要花费用户较多的信息处理成本进行脱敏处理和设定,比较麻烦。

技术实现思路

[0006]为了解决上述问题,本申请提出一种基于移动设备的防截屏方法及系统和电子设备。
[0007]本申请一方面,提出一种基于移动设备的防截屏方法,包括如下步骤:登录云端应用平台,选择目标应用并进行截屏操作;获取用户截屏时的云操作数据,从所述云操作数据中获取截屏页面以及所述截屏页面中的应用信息;
从所述应用信息中提取得到文本信息,并判断所述文本信息中是否存在敏感词;若所述文本信息中存在敏感词,则利用所述敏感词对所述截屏页面进行特征标记,并向用户发出警告,根据用户反馈指令选择是否截屏。
[0008]作为本申请的一可选实施方案,可选地,登录云端应用平台,选择目标应用并进行截屏操作,包括:用户通过终端登录云服务器;从所述云服务器上所部署的云端应用平台上,选择目标应用,并从所述目标应用中调取出用户需要截屏的页面信息;将所述页面信息发送至所述终端,等待用户确定所述页面信息并在终端上进行截屏操作;所述终端同步将用户进行操作截屏时的云操作数据回传至所述云服务器进行存储。
[0009]作为本申请的一可选实施方案,可选地,获取用户截屏时的云操作数据,从所述云操作数据中获取截屏页面,包括:从所述云服务器中提取出用户截屏时的云操作数据;根据预设的数据解析规则,将所述云操作数据进行解析,得到用户截屏时的云操作信息以及所截屏页面的图像信息;按照解析数据类型,从解析得到的云操作信息以及所截屏页面的图像信息中,提取得到用户截屏时的截屏页面。
[0010]作为本申请的一可选实施方案,可选地,从所述云操作数据中获取截屏页面以及所述截屏页面中的应用信息,包括:获取所提取得到的用户截屏时的截屏页面;将所述截屏页面导入预先部署在所述云端应用平台上的图片解析与识别应用中,对所述截屏页面进行图文识别,获得所述截屏页面中的图片应用信息及文本应用信息;按照图文的类型进行分类,分别输出所述截屏页面中所包含的图片应用信息及文本应用信息,按照类型回传至所述云服务器并分别进行存储。
[0011]作为本申请的一可选实施方案,可选地,从所述应用信息中提取得到文本信息,并判断所述文本信息中是否存在敏感词,包括:从所述云服务器中提取出所述截屏页面中所包含的文本应用信息;对所述文本应用信息进行文本识别,提取得到所述文本应用信息中的应用关键词;将提取得到的所有关键词逐一输入预先部署的敏感词数据库中,判断所述关键词是否存在于与当前应用相对应的所述敏感词数据库中:若存在,则标记当前的所述关键词为所述截屏页面中的所述文本应用信息的敏感词;反之,则导出当前的所述关键词,并输入下一个所述关键词进行判断。
[0012]作为本申请的一可选实施方案,可选地,所述敏感词数据库中包含若干个子数据库;所述子数据库部署于所述云服务器上,且与部署在所述云端应用平台上的各个应
用相对应;所述字数据库部中存储有所述应用及应用页面的敏感词。
[0013]作为本申请的一可选实施方案,可选地,若所述文本信息中存在敏感词,则利用所述敏感词对所述截屏页面进行特征标记,并向用户发出警告,根据用户反馈指令选择是否截屏,包括:当判断所述文本应用信息中存在敏感词,表示当前所述截屏页面需要进行敏感警告;获取当前所述截屏页面中的所述敏感词,并将所述敏感词作为敏感特征标记在所述截屏页面上;所述云服务器向用户终端发出所述截屏页面的敏感告警提示,等待用户查看提示页面上的所述敏感词,根据所述敏感词选择是否确定当前的所述截屏页面。
[0014]作为本申请的一可选实施方案,可选地,若所述文本信息中存在敏感词,则利用所述敏感词对所述截屏页面进行特征标记,并向用户发出警告,根据用户反馈指令选择是否截屏,还包括:通过终端接收所述云服务器发出的所述截屏页面的敏感告警提示;用户在终端上查看提示页面上的所述敏感词,对当前的所述截屏页面进行确认,判断是否进行截屏,并发出响应至所述云服务器;所述云服务器接收到确定进行截屏的响应,将当前的所述截屏页面发送至终端并展示。
[0015]本申请另一方面,提出一种实现所述的基于移动设备的防截屏方法的系统,包括:截屏模块,用于登录云端应用平台,选择目标应用并进行截屏操作;云处理模块,用于获取用户截屏时的云操作数据,从所述云操作数据中获取截屏页面以及所述截屏页面中的应用信息;脱敏识别模块,用于从所述应用信息中提取得到文本信息,并判断所述文本信息中是否存在敏感词;截屏告警模块,用于若所述文本信息中存在敏感词,则利用所述敏感词对所述截屏页面进行特征标记,并向用户发出警告,根据用户反馈指令选择是否截屏。
[0016]本申请另一方面,还提出一种电子设备,包括:处理器;用于存储处理器可执行指令的存储器;其中,所述处理器被配置为执行所述可执行指令时实现所述的一种基于移动设备的防截屏方法。
[0017]本专利技术的技术效果:本申请通过登录云端应用平台,选择目标应用并进行截屏操作;获取本文档来自技高网
...

【技术保护点】

【技术特征摘要】
1.一种基于移动设备的防截屏方法,其特征在于,包括如下步骤:登录云端应用平台,选择目标应用并进行截屏操作;获取用户截屏时的云操作数据,从所述云操作数据中获取截屏页面以及所述截屏页面中的应用信息;从所述应用信息中提取得到文本信息,并判断所述文本信息中是否存在敏感词;若所述文本信息中存在敏感词,则利用所述敏感词对所述截屏页面进行特征标记,并向用户发出警告,根据用户反馈指令选择是否截屏。2.根据权利要求1所述的一种基于移动设备的防截屏方法,其特征在于,登录云端应用平台,选择目标应用并进行截屏操作,包括:用户通过终端登录云服务器;从所述云服务器上所部署的云端应用平台上,选择目标应用,并从所述目标应用中调取出用户需要截屏的页面信息;将所述页面信息发送至所述终端,等待用户确定所述页面信息并在终端上进行截屏操作;所述终端同步将用户进行操作截屏时的云操作数据回传至所述云服务器进行存储。3.根据权利要求1所述的一种基于移动设备的防截屏方法,其特征在于,获取用户截屏时的云操作数据,从所述云操作数据中获取截屏页面,包括:从所述云服务器中提取出用户截屏时的云操作数据;根据预设的数据解析规则,将所述云操作数据进行解析,得到用户截屏时的云操作信息以及所截屏页面的图像信息;按照解析数据类型,从解析得到的云操作信息以及所截屏页面的图像信息中,提取得到用户截屏时的截屏页面。4.根据权利要求3所述的一种基于移动设备的防截屏方法,其特征在于,从所述云操作数据中获取截屏页面以及所述截屏页面中的应用信息,包括:获取所提取得到的用户截屏时的截屏页面;将所述截屏页面导入预先部署在所述云端应用平台上的图片解析与识别应用中,对所述截屏页面进行图文识别,获得所述截屏页面中的图片应用信息及文本应用信息;按照图文的类型进行分类,分别输出所述截屏页面中所包含的图片应用信息及文本应用信息,按照类型回传至所述云服务器并分别进行存储。5.根据权利要求4所述的一种基于移动设备的防截屏方法,其特征在于,从所述应用信息中提取得到文本信息,并判断所述文本信息中是否存在敏感词,包括:从所述云服务器中提取出所述截屏页面中所包含的文本应用信息;对所述文本应用信息进行文本识别,提取得到所述文本应用信息中的应用关键词;将提取得到的所有关键词逐一输入预先部署的敏感词数据库中,判断所述关键词是否存在于与当前应用相对应的所述敏感词数据库中:若存...

【专利技术属性】
技术研发人员:王为黄予昕徐梓铎岳翀付皓陈家健
申请(专利权)人:海道深圳教育科技有限责任公司
类型:发明
国别省市:

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1